Cheddleton provides amenities including local independent retailers along Cheadle Road and within the nearby Leek town centre, supermarkets such as a large Sainsbury's, Morrisons, and an Aldi in nearby Leek, the Royal Stoke University Hospital in nearby Stoke-on-Trent, and schools such as Cheddleton St Edward's CC First School and Westwood College in Leek, making it highly attractive to families and working professionals. Features include the historic Cheddleton Flint Mill, the nearby Churnet Valley Railway, and scenic walking routes along the Caldon Canal paths, through the local Deep Haye Country Park trails, and around the grounds of nearby RSPB Coombes Valley. Transport is via a short line to Stoke-on-Trent railway station with direct links to Manchester Piccadilly, Birmingham New Street, and London Euston, with major road links including the A520, the A53, and the M6.

What is FENSA? FENSA (Fenestration Self-Assessment Scheme) is a government-authorised scheme that monitors building regulation compliance for replacement windows and doors. Certificates indicate that work was completed by FENSA-approved installers.

  •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
  •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
  •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
  •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
  • Cost-to-rent — Price ÷ annual rent (from OpenRent comparables). Under 14× = strong, 14–16× = acceptable, 17×+ = compressed.
  • Cashflow — Rent minus mortgage, 10% maintenance, £25/mo compliance. Assumes 75% LTV, 3.95% APR (5yr fixed), 25yr term.
  • ROI — Annual profit ÷ cash in (deposit + 4% purchase costs).
